Media art is here returns in 2025, once again bringing art to where life happens: on streets, squares, and in gardens. Visitors encounter forward-thinking media artworks that rethink and transform public spaces—interactive, inspiring, and freely accessible.

The exhibition features works by both local and international artists who explore the boundaries between physical and virtual space, while addressing the impact of digital media on society, identity, and sustainability. Placed directly within the urban environment, the artworks open up new, unexpected perspectives and foster dialogue between art, the city, and society.

The exhibition not only offers aesthetic experiences but also creates new forms of participation: many works invite active involvement and make media art directly accessible to a wide audience. Presented in parallel with the SCHLOSSLICHTSPIELE Light Festival, the exhibition invites visitors to rediscover Karlsruhe through media and light art.

Media art is here is realised by the Department of Cultural Affairs of the City of Karlsruhe in close cooperation with the ZKM | Center for Art and Media. The event is part of the Art | Summer | Technology series organized by KIT.

A moment in Otto Piene's installation Light Room (Jena) (2005 / 2017), seen in Electric Dreams exhibition in Tate Modern 2025. Oh I so wish that light artists would come up with more imaginative names for their pieces (looking at you, Robert Irwin, with all your Light & Spaces), even if in this case the name was apt. Filled with a collection of quite a classic light art machinery with perforated, rotating and reflecting parts, the space was filled with spotted and wavelike light. It felt like entering a surrealist clock. Which is always nice.

Encounter Trees – Modena x Karlsruhe

Fasanenschlösschen, Friday, June 27 at 06:00 PM GMT+2

[↓ German Version Below ↓]

As part of ArchitekturZeit, the two UNESCO Creative Cities Modena and Karlsruhe engage in a creative dialogue. The exhibition Encounter Trees – Modena x Karlsruhe explores the fascinating relationship between humans, nature, and design. At the heart of the exhibition lies the visionary work of Italian architect Cesare Leonardi (1935–2021), whose practice spans architecture, urban planning, photography, design, and art. His interdisciplinary approach combines design research with artistic experimentation—an invitation to understand design not only as form, but as a cultural force.

Encounter Trees highlights two central aspects of Leonardi’s work: his extensive tree drawings and his sustainable furniture design. Together with Franca Stagi (1937–2008), he documented over 300 tree species, analyzing their shadow patterns and seasonal color changes to inform the design of parks and shared public spaces. Starting in the 1980s, he also developed the Solids, a series of modular, handcrafted wooden furniture pieces as a sustainable alternative to industrial design.

Leonardi’s interdisciplinary approach is brought to life in the exhibition through original drawings, prototypes, photographs, and multimedia installations. Visitors are invited to freely explore different thematic areas and rediscover the interplay between design, nature, and urban landscapes in the unique setting of the Fasanenschlösschen. The exhibition is complemented by interactive workshops that encourage hands-on exploration of design principles and direct engagement with the trees in the surrounding Fasanengarten.

Im Rahmen der ArchitekturZeit treten die beiden UNESCO Creative Cities Modena und Karlsruhe in einen kreativen Dialog. Die Ausstellung Encounter Trees – Modena x Karlsruhe erkundet die faszinierende Beziehung zwischen Mensch, Natur und Design. Im Mittelpunkt der Ausstellung steht das visionäre Werk des italienischen Architekten Cesare Leonardi (1935–2021), dessen Arbeit sich in der Schnittstelle zwischen Architektur, Stadtplanung, Fotografie, Design und Kunst bewegt. Seine interdisziplinäre Praxis vereint gestalterische Forschung mit künstlerischem Experiment – Eine Einladung, Design nicht nur als Form, sondern als kulturelle Kraft zu verstehen.

Encounter Trees beleuchtet zwei zentrale Aspekte von Leonardis Schaffen: Seine umfassenden Zeichnungen von Bäumen sowie sein nachhaltiges Möbeldesign. Gemeinsam mit Franca Stagi (1937-2008) dokumentierte er über 300 Baumarten und untersuchte ihre Schattenwirkung sowie jahreszeitlichen Farbveränderungen für die Gestaltung von Parks und kollektiven Räumen. Ab den 1980er-Jahren entwickelte er zudem die Solids, eine Serie modularer, handwerklich gefertigter Holzmöbel, als nachhaltige Alternative zum industriellen Design.

Leonardis interdisziplinärer Ansatz wird in der Ausstellung durch Originalzeichnungen, Prototypen, Fotografien und multimediale Installationen erlebbar. Besucherinnen und Besucher können sich frei durch die verschiedenen Themenbereiche bewegen und die Wechselwirkungen zwischen Design, Natur und Stadtlandschaft im einzigartigen Umfeld des Fasanenschlösschens neu entdecken. Ergänzt wird die Ausstellung durch interaktive Workshops, die dazu einladen, die Design-Prinzipien praktisch zu erkunden und in Kontakt mit den Bäumen im unmittelbaren Umfeld des Fasanengartens zu treten.

What Is the DARC Indigenous Residency Program?

Presented with the support of The Hnatyshyn Foundation, DARC’s Indigenous Residency is a one-month intensive on-site artist residency, offered to mid-career #Indigenous ( #FirstNations / #Inuit & #Métis) artists who are seeking to develop their current practice, experiment with a new medium, or continue an existing project.

Artists in residence are provided with access to DARC’s facilities, including the DARC Microcinema, Soundstage, Digital Edit Suite, and Recording Studio. Artists also have access to an array of audio-visual equipment and up to 16 hours of advisor time for the duration of their residency.

Following the residency, artists are expected to participate in an artist talk to discuss their practice and share works in progress or any completed projects from their residency.

Residency Support Includes:

Artist residency fee of $2,500;
Up to $4,000 in DARC equipment and facility waivers for the duration of the residency;
Access to DARC technical consultations;
An opportunity to present your work publicly through a screening, exhibition, or artist talk;
A fee of $520 for an artist talk or presentation of your work according to current CARFAC-RAAV fee schedule;
Honorarium for parking or transit for local artists;
A fee of $1504 (CARFAC-RAAV fee schedule) for an artistic advisor of your choosing or Indigenous advisor recommended by DARC for 16 hrs of consultation;
For artists who are not based in the Ottawa – Gatineau region: Up to $1500 housing subsidy
and up to $1750 in travel expenditures;
A full festival pass to the Asinabka Film & Media Arts Festival;
Ongoing support through membership at DARC following the completion of the residency, including free access to workshops for one year.
